Câu hỏi được gắn thẻ «log4net»

Thư viện Apache log4net là một công cụ giúp lập trình viên xuất ra các câu lệnh nhật ký cho nhiều mục tiêu đầu ra khác nhau. log4net là một cổng của khuôn khổ Apache log4j ™ tuyệt vời vào thời gian chạy Microsoft® .NET. Chúng tôi đã giữ nguyên khuôn khổ tương tự như bản log4j ban đầu trong khi tận dụng các tính năng mới trong thời gian chạy .NET.



4
Cách sử dụng log4net (đặt tên trình ghi nhật ký) đúng
Có hai cách để cấu hình và sử dụng log4net. Đầu tiên là khi tôi có thể định cấu hình appender của riêng mình và trình ghi liên kết: <!-- language: xml --> <appender name="myLogAppender" type="log4net.Appender.RollingFileAppender" > <file value="Logs\myLog.log" /> <layout type="log4net.Layout.PatternLayout"> <conversionPattern value="%date %level - %message%n" /> </layout> </appender> …




9
Log4net sẽ tạo tệp nhật ký này ở đâu?
Khi tôi đặt giá trị tệp thành logs\log-file.txt, chính xác thì nó sẽ tạo thư mục này ở đâu? Trong /bindanh bạ? Web.config của tôi trông như thế này: <log4net> <appender name="FileAppender" type="log4net.Appender.FileAppender"> <file value="logs\log-file.txt" /> <appendToFile value="true" /> <lockingModel type="log4net.Appender.FileAppender+MinimalLock" /> <layout type="log4net.Layout.PatternLayout"> <conversionPattern value="%date [%thread] %-5level %logger [%property{NDC}] …

11
Làm cách nào để thay đổi vị trí tệp theo lập trình?
Tôi hoàn toàn mới đối với Log4net. Tôi đã quản lý để đạt được điều gì đó bằng cách thêm tệp cấu hình và ghi nhật ký đơn giản. Tôi đã mã hóa giá trị để được "C:\temp\log.txt"nhưng điều này không đủ tốt. Nhật ký phải chuyển đến các thư …
75 c#  log4net 
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.